You're going to get a lot of these words that seem at first blush to be empty neologisms but which fulfill a definite need. Proactive is one. You could say active but that doesn't stress the idea that you are taking an action with the specific intent of forestalling some undesired condition that reactive has to wait for before it gets to be used.
